On the afternoon of the 28th, in response to a wildfire in the Buk District of Daegu, the city of Daegu and forestry authorities will undertake nighttime firefighting efforts to prevent the fire from spreading into densely populated areas.
Acting Daegu Mayor Kim Jeong-gi noted at a briefing that they plan to deploy the Surion helicopter, which is capable of nighttime firefighting, to the scene.
The Surion helicopter is the only model capable of nighttime firefighting. Earlier, firefighting authorities had deployed 29 general firefighting helicopters to the fire site during the day but withdrew all of them when transitioning to a nighttime response system.
The city of Daegu and forestry authorities issued a mandatory evacuation order to residents of the nearby Seobyeon-dong apartment complex in preparation for the possibility of the fire spreading overnight. The number of affected individuals is approximately 3,400.
After the fire broke out, residents of Nogok-dong and Mutaejo-yadong evacuated to nearby elementary schools, resulting in no casualties. Some schools issued a closure order for the 29th.
As of 8 p.m. on that day, the area affected by the wildfire was 151 hectares, the fire line was 8.6 kilometers, and the firefighting rate was 19%. The fire is estimated to have started around 2:01 p.m. in a restricted entry area.
